Well, You'd have to decrypt(all stages) of their launcher.dat, scour the code to figure out how and where it checks to see if a gateway card is inserted, and then modify the code to always return true... But, in the past this risked triggering hidden bricking code, so unless gateway removed the brick code, or you can figure out how the brick code works and disable it, you're basically at where most people are now, which is starting from scratch and NOT using modified versions of gateway's launcher.dat

The whole reason for "gateway mode" and "classic mode" to both exist is because in gateway mode the cart slot is accessed differently to talk to the fpga in the red cart. This is why you need to go in to a different software mode ("classic mode") to read a retail cart.
For lack of knowing the ACTUAL things going on, one could say the gateway team wrote their own cart slot driver for the red card to be fully utilized and that driver has to be switched back to stock to read a game cart.
